Everything you're asking for is very short sighted and fixated on winning this year.
If we don't move him, we have to sign a 29 year old to a UFA premium deal that will reach $8M+ which will hamper our ability to keep our big 3 or 4 together. See Toronto's cap hell.
We're not selling a guy just to sell a guy. We're trading him for valuable assets, prospect, picks, cheaper team controlled roster player and we offload some salary. Good for the future.
We added more in the last 30 days than ever before. Whatever dynamic Kreider brings, we can replace with similar or different attributes. Can't fall in love with what a single player brings and over commit.
Finished with rebuild doesn't mean we are going to start being reckless. Staal, Smith, Shattenkirk, and Lundqvist eating up $26M is not the starting point of winning a cup. Chytil, Andersson, Kravtsov, Fox, Kakko having 0-50 games in the NHL also isn't the timing when we're ready to compete. Let the cheesecake cool for 6 hours out of the oven before it's ready.

I agree with all this except for the part that we're finished with the rebuild. We're just moving into another phase of it. Gorton said after we won the lottery that that was going to accelerate everything--in the meantime we have picked up Fox and Trouba (a young vet) and Panarin. But 6 1st rounders and Howden in three years-- a bunch of 2nd rounders + Hajek, Rykov and Lindgren. Even some of our later draft picks like Shestyorkin, Reunanen and Barron are really looking good. Next year we have 9 draft picks lined up and if the major piece we get back for Kreider is a draft pick that should be another 1st which could give us 8 in 4 years. It looks to me like the Rangers are all in on draft and development and we're going to have a ****load of ELC's and second contracts for the foreseeable future. There will come a time when we will have to start paying some of them but it probably ain't going to happen all at once and it doesn't mean we won't have other kids coming along to fight for jobs either.
